The keystone remoteproc driver performs an error recovery by scheduling
a workqueue from the keystone_remoteproc_exception_interrupt() handler
when using in-kernel remoteproc core loader/boot mechanism. This interrupt
is registered with IRQF_ONESHOT at the moment, and it results in a
"scheduling while atomic" BUG when running on RT-Linux. Oneshot interrupts
keep the irq line masked until the threaded handler has finished, and
the workqueue scheduling uses spinlocks for synchronization which get
transformed to rt_mutexes on RT. So, fix this by not using IRQF_ONESHOT
while requesting the interrupt. This interrupt is processed by UIO
framework when using the userspace based load/boot mechanism, and
doesn't need any changes in that path.

Inside print_request(), we query the context/timeline name. Nothing
immediately protects the context from being freed if the request is
complete -- we rely on serialisation by the caller to keep the name
valid until they finish using it. Inside intel_engine_dump(), we
generally only print the requsts in the execution queue protected by the
engine->active.lock, but we also show the pending execlists ports which
are not protected and so require an rcu_read_lock to keep the pointer
valid.
